The Importance of Clean Drinking Water
The human body is composed of approximately 60% water, which plays a critical role in bodily functions. Water aids in digestion, regulates body temperature, and helps in nutrient transportation. However, not all water is created equal. Tap water, while generally safe in many regions, can contain contaminants such as chlorine, lead, and bacteria, which can pose health risks over time.
Drinking clean water is crucial for maintaining good health. Contaminated water can lead to a range of health issues, from gastrointestinal illnesses to long-term chronic conditions. This makes access to clean drinking water not just a convenience but a necessity.
Benefits of Filtered Water
Improved Taste and Odor
One of the most immediate benefits of filtered water is its taste. Many people find that tap water has a distinct taste or odor, often due to chlorine or other chemicals used in the purification process. A water dispenser equipped with a high-quality filter removes these impurities, resulting in water that is fresher and more palatable. This encourages greater water consumption, which is vital for staying hydrated.
Removal of Contaminants
Filtered water significantly reduces the presence of harmful contaminants. Advanced filtration systems can eliminate bacteria, viruses, heavy metals, and even microplastics. By removing these substances, filtered water can reduce the risk of waterborne diseases and chronic health issues, making it a safer choice for you and your family.
Better for the Environment
Using a water dispenser with a filtration system is an eco-friendly alternative to bottled water. Each year, millions of plastic bottles end up in landfills, contributing to environmental degradation. By opting for filtered water, you not only reduce plastic waste but also minimize your carbon footprint associated with the production and transportation of bottled water.
